Transaction 509424330729b92771c32b4d0f8e8ecc8d25e7d43d1777858590cd02cfccca4e

1 Input
2 Outputs
  • 509424330729b92771c32b4d0f8e8ecc8d25e7d43d1777858590cd02cfccca4e:0
  • value  201796
    address  3NCFHRJeMZ2afu7sw8nitvDqkPFAUpsXsi
  • 509424330729b92771c32b4d0f8e8ecc8d25e7d43d1777858590cd02cfccca4e:1
  • value  221904817
    address  bc1qk8alj6cryw5g0z8xz39q3nagy77ye3m8uyvgjj